TSX:VUN (Vanguard U.S. Total Market Index ETF)

About VUN

The investment objective of Vanguard U.S. Total Market Index ETF (the ETF) is to track, to the extent reasonably possible and before fees and expenses, the performance of the CRSP US Total Market Index (the Index or the Benchmark). The Index is a market capitalization-weighted index representing the returns of large-, mid-, small- and micro-capitalization stocks in the United States. The fund seeks to track, to the extent reasonably possible and before fees and expenses, the performance of a broad U.S. equityindex that measures the investment returns of primarily large-capitalization U.S. stocks. Currently, this Vanguard ETF seeks totrack the CRSP US Total Market Index (CAD-hedged) (or any successor thereto). It invests directly or indirectly primarily in stocksof U.S. companies.
